Easy Hawaiian Pasta Salad

This Hawaiian pasta salad recipe is the perfect way to enjoy a taste of the tropics all year long.
Servings 12
Calories 300kcal

Ingredients

Cold Pasta Salad Ingredients:

  • 1 lb (450g) uncooked elbow macaroni or other pasta shape of your choice
  • 1 - 2 teaspoons olive oil
  • 4 cups cubed ham
  • 28 ounces pineapple chunks drained and juice reserved for salad dressing
  • 2 red peppers deseeded and chopped
  • 2 carrots peeled and cut into matchsticks
  • 4 green onions sliced
  • salt
  • black pepper

Pineapple Dressing Ingredients:

  • 1 cup mayonnaise
  • 4 tablespoons sour cream
  • 1/2 cup pineapple juice reserved from the pineapple tins
  • 1 tablespoon whole grain mustard or Dijon mustard
  • 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ar

Instructions

To Make Hawaiian Pasta Salad:

  • Cook pasta according to packet instructions (you will want it to be al dente).
  • Drain the pasta and add in a couple of teaspoons of olive oil to keep it from sticking. Allow pasta to cool.
  • Meanwhile, make the Hawaiian pasta salad pineapple dressing by adding all ingredients together and whisk till smooth. Set aside.
  • In a large bowl, combine pasta, ham, pineapple bits, red pepper, carrots, green onions, salt and pepper. Then add in the dressing and mix the Hawaiian mac salad till combined.
  • Taste and adjust seasonings if needed.
  • Cover the Hawaiian macaroni salad and chill until you are ready to serve your cold pasta salad.

Hawaiian Pasta Salad Tips

  • When waiting for the pasta to cool, add 1- 2 teaspoons of olive oil and toss to prevent the pasta from sticking.
  • This recipe typically calls for smooth Dijon mustard, but I love the bite that a whole grain mustard provides.
  • You can use the traditional elbow macaroni, but any pasta shape works well. Or make this Hawaiian Pasta Salad with whole wheat pasta or gluten free pasta instead.
  • To make this Hawaiian mac salad a bit healthier, I used half fat mayo. But you can make it with full fat mayonnaise if you prefer.
